[RFC PATCH 3/3] cxl/test: Exercise Type-2 automatic region creation

Richard Cheng <[email protected]> Wed, 5 Aug 2026 15:40:42 +0800
Newsgroups org.kernel.vger.linux-cxl,org.kernel.vger.linux-kernel
Message-ID <[email protected]>
Add a second mock Type-2 accelerator with an independent single-target
CFMWS and an uncommitted manual DEVMEM decoder. Keep the existing
FW-precomitted accelerator unchanged.

Verify that devm_cxl_probe_mem() creates the missing region and returns
a valid 512 MB HPA range. Preserve the manual decoder config after reset
so the fallback remains available across unbind and rebind.
